flag New Zealand researchers created an AI tool that predicts wildfires faster and more accurately than traditional models.

flag Researchers at the University of Canterbury have developed an AI-powered wildfire forecasting system that updates every 30 minutes, improving prediction accuracy by 10% to 30% compared to traditional daily models. flag Tested across Australian regions using over 60 years of data, the machine learning tool identifies rising fire risk faster and reduces false alarms. flag Because it relies on existing weather stations, the system could be easily adopted in New Zealand and other areas, helping agencies respond more effectively to the growing threat of wildfires.
